版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
中国移动面试增强现实技术手册增强现实(AugmentedReality,AR)技术通过将数字信息叠加到现实世界中,为用户创造沉浸式的交互体验。在中国移动的面试中,理解AR技术的基本原理、应用场景、关键技术及发展趋势,对于应聘者至关重要。本文将系统梳理AR技术的核心概念、技术架构、典型应用及未来方向,为应聘者提供全面的参考。一、增强现实技术的基本概念增强现实技术是一种将数字信息(如图像、声音、文字、三维模型等)实时叠加到用户所看到的真实世界中的技术。与虚拟现实(VirtualReality,VR)完全沉浸虚拟环境不同,AR技术保留了现实环境的完整性,通过透明化的方式将数字内容与物理世界融合。AR技术的核心在于“虚实结合”与“实时交互”,其基本原理包括以下几个关键要素:1.感知与追踪:AR系统需要实时感知用户的环境和位置,通常通过摄像头、传感器(如IMU、GPS、深度摄像头等)实现。这些设备能够捕捉用户的视场、动作及周围环境特征,为数字信息的叠加提供基础。2.定位与映射:系统需确定数字内容在现实世界中的准确位置和姿态。这依赖于SLAM(SimultaneousLocalizationandMapping,即时定位与地图构建)、特征点识别等技术,确保数字对象与现实场景无缝对齐。3.渲染与融合:数字内容需要以透明或半透明的方式叠加到现实画面中,通常通过屏幕融合(Screen-DoorEffect,SDE)或光学混合(OpticalSee-Through)实现。渲染效果直接影响用户体验的真实感与沉浸度。4.交互与反馈:用户通过手势、语音、触摸等方式与AR内容交互,系统需实时响应并反馈操作结果,增强交互的自然性。二、增强现实的技术架构AR系统的技术架构通常包括硬件、软件和算法三个层面,各部分协同工作以实现功能。1.硬件基础AR硬件是技术实现的基础,主要包括:-显示设备:AR眼镜(如MicrosoftHoloLens、MagicLeap)、智能手机、平板电脑等。显示技术分为透视式(OpticalSee-Through)和反射式(ReflectionSeeminglySee-Through),前者通过半透明镜片将数字内容与真实世界融合,后者则通过反射式显示屏实现。-传感器:摄像头、IMU(惯性测量单元)、深度传感器(如结构光或ToF)、GPS、雷达等,用于环境感知和定位。-计算平台:高性能处理器(如NVIDIAJetson、高通骁龙系列)和边缘计算设备,支持实时数据处理和渲染。2.软件系统AR软件系统包括操作系统、开发框架和算法库:-操作系统:Android、iOS、Windows等,提供基础运行环境。-开发框架:ARKit(苹果)、ARCore(谷歌)、Unity、UnrealEngine等,提供场景构建、渲染优化、交互设计等工具。-核心算法:SLAM算法、特征点检测与匹配、光流算法、几何约束求解等,用于环境理解与定位。3.云端支持随着AR应用复杂度的提升,云端计算成为重要补充:-数据同步:通过5G网络实时传输高精度地图、模型库、用户行为数据等。-AI赋能:利用云端AI模型进行图像识别、语音交互、自然语言处理等,提升AR系统的智能化水平。三、增强现实的关键技术AR技术的实现依赖于多项关键技术,其中SLAM、计算机视觉和渲染技术尤为重要。1.SLAM技术SLAM是AR定位与映射的核心,通过摄像头和IMU等传感器,实时构建环境地图并确定设备位置。SLAM分为基于特征点的方法(如ORB-SLAM)和基于直接法的方法(如DynaSLAM),前者依赖环境特征点进行定位,后者通过光流优化减少特征依赖。在移动AR中,SLAM技术需兼顾精度与功耗,通常采用优化算法(如粒子滤波、图优化)提升性能。2.计算机视觉计算机视觉技术为AR提供环境理解能力,包括:-图像识别:通过深度学习模型(如CNN)识别物体、场景、文字等,实现数字内容的锚定。例如,扫描特定平面时,系统可在此平面叠加虚拟模型。-手势识别:通过摄像头捕捉用户手势,实现无接触交互。例如,挥手切换AR内容或触发操作。-人脸识别与表情追踪:在社交AR应用中,系统可实时分析用户表情并同步到虚拟形象,增强互动性。3.渲染技术渲染技术决定数字内容与现实世界的融合效果:-透明度融合:通过半透明屏幕或投影技术,使数字内容与真实环境叠加。例如,AR导航时,箭头叠加在真实街道上。-光照匹配:调整数字对象的光照参数,使其与现实环境的光线、阴影一致,提升真实感。-遮挡处理:当数字对象被现实物体遮挡时,系统需自动调整渲染顺序,避免视觉冲突。四、增强现实的应用场景AR技术在多个领域展现出巨大潜力,以下是中国移动可能涉及的重点应用方向。1.增强社交与娱乐AR滤镜、社交游戏、虚拟合影等应用通过手机摄像头实时叠加数字内容,增强社交互动。例如,微信的AR滤镜利用计算机视觉识别用户面部,叠加特效动画;Roblox等平台则通过AR技术实现线下社交游戏的线上延伸。2.工业与制造业AR在工业培训、设备维护、装配指导等方面发挥重要作用:-远程协作:专家通过AR眼镜实时指导现场工人,解决复杂问题。-装配辅助:AR系统在装配过程中叠加步骤说明,减少错误率。-质量检测:通过AR摄像头检测产品缺陷,提高检测效率。3.教育与培训AR技术可创建沉浸式学习环境:-虚拟实验:学生通过AR设备观察分子结构或历史场景,增强理解。-技能培训:飞行员通过AR模拟器进行操作训练,降低培训成本。4.医疗领域AR在手术导航、病理分析、康复训练中应用广泛:-手术导航:医生通过AR眼镜叠加患者CT数据,实现精准手术。-远程会诊:专家通过AR技术实时指导基层医生诊断病情。5.导航与出行AR导航通过手机摄像头将路线信息叠加在真实场景中,提供更直观的导航体验。例如,高德地图的AR导航功能在街景中标注方向箭头。6.增强零售AR试穿、虚拟展厅等应用提升购物体验:-虚拟试衣:用户通过手机摄像头试穿衣物,实时预览效果。-商品展示:家具商通过AR技术展示产品在实际家居中的效果。五、增强现实的发展趋势AR技术仍处于快速发展阶段,未来将呈现以下趋势:1.5G与边缘计算融合:5G的高带宽、低时延特性将支持更复杂的AR应用,而边缘计算可减轻云端负担,提升实时性。2.AI与AR的深度结合:AI模型将优化AR系统的理解能力,实现更智能的交互。例如,通过语音指令自动调整AR内容。3.轻量化硬件:AR眼镜将趋向轻薄化、智能化,提升佩戴舒适度与续航能力。4.行业应用深化:AR在工业、医疗、教育等领域的应用将更加成熟,形成标准化解决方案。5.隐私与安全:随着AR应用普及,数据隐私与安全将成为重要议题,需通过加密、匿名化等技术保障用户权益。六、面试准备建议应聘中国移动AR相关岗位时,建议重点准备以下内容:1.技术基础:熟悉SLAM、计算机视觉、渲染等技术原理,了解主流AR平台(如ARKit、ARCore)的特点。2.行业案例:分析中国移动在
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 房屋作价协议书
- 2025普通合伙企业合同协议书
- 师徒协议书的转让协议书
- 因果广播协议书
- ospf路由协议书实验
- 影片剪辑许可协议书
- tcp协议书中的nagle算法
- 伽马协议书电影
- 总线通信协议书有哪些
- 以太网协议书和ssh协议书
- 泌尿结石健康宣教
- 2025年司法协理员考试真题及答案
- 2025-2026学年黑龙江省齐齐哈尔市初二数学上册期中考试试卷及答案
- 2025铁路知识竞赛题库附答案(423题)
- 合肥菜场买卖合同范本
- 海南省水利灌区管理局招聘笔试真题2024
- 2024年市场监管总局直属事业单位招聘真题
- 水质检测培训
- 探析缅甸小说《如愿》的审美文化价值
- 1.1 昆虫(教学设计)科学青岛版三年级上册(新教材)
- 锦瑟课件李商隐
评论
0/150
提交评论